Delta Air Lines recently announced significant changes to its international route network, canceling operations on several routes due to a combination of shifting market demands, rising operational costs, and a strategic shift to focus on more profitable routes. This decision reflects the complex challenges currently facing the airline industry, particularly for U.S. carriers navigating an evolving post-pandemic travel landscape.

 

Among the routes affected are several transatlantic flights, particularly to secondary European cities where demand has not rebounded to pre-pandemic levels. Delta’s operations to certain destinations in Germany, Italy, and Spain will be scaled back or fully canceled, leaving passengers with fewer options for direct flights from the United States to these locations. Similarly, some services to Asian and South American cities have been cut, primarily where Delta had struggled to compete with local and regional airlines offering more competitive fares or more convenient schedules.

 

The decision to cancel these routes comes amid heightened economic pressures, with fuel prices, staffing costs, and general inflation driving up the expenses associated with long-haul international flights. Delta, like many other carriers, has been reevaluating its route profitability as part of a larger strategy to stabilize finances and improve service in core markets. The airline remains committed to high-demand international routes, such as those between major U.S. hubs and key global cities like London, Paris, and Tokyo, where partnerships with other carriers allow for more robust passenger services.

 

Delta’s move has drawn mixed reactions. Frequent international travelers have voiced disappointment, especially those who relied on Delta’s more unique routes for business or personal connections. However, industry analysts acknowledge that Delta’s focus on route profitability is necessary to ensure the long-term sustainability of its operations. By concentrating on fewer, high-demand routes, Delta can improve efficiency, allocate more resources toward service quality, and maintain a stronger financial footing amid an unpredictable economic environment.

 

The airline has assured affected customers that they will be accommodated as seamlessly as possible, either by rebooking them on partner airlines or providing alternative flight options through Delta’s main hubs. Delta also remains optimistic that some of the suspended routes may resume in the future if demand justifies their return.

 

While these changes signal a reduced footprint in certain international markets, Delta’s strategic pivot underscores the broader industry trend of consolidation and recalibration. In a statement, Delta reaffirmed its commitment to serving international travelers with “efficiency, reliability, and a focus on our core markets.” As global travel patterns continue to evolve, Delta’s streamlined international operations aim to better position the airline for sustainabl

e growth.
